The following providers offer the AUR20920 Certificate II in Automotive Body Repair Technology in Tweed Heads.Entry requirements
Entry requirements set by ASQA are the basic qualifications and criteria that students must meet before enrolling in a nationally recognised course.
These requirements ensure students have the skills and knowledge needed to undertake this course.
- There are no formal academic requirements
- Additional entry requirements are set by individual course providers

Career opportunities
The Certificate II in Automotive Body Repair Technology will prepare you for the following roles.
Spray Painter
